What Is Microsoft Secure Score — and How Can You Improve It?
Microsoft Secure Score gives your organisation a numerical view of its security posture across the Microsoft services you use.
A higher score generally means more of Microsoft’s recommended security actions have been completed.
That sounds simple.
But Secure Score is frequently misunderstood.
It is not:
a cyber-security certification
proof that your organisation cannot be breached
a direct percentage chance of being secure
a reason to enable every recommendation blindly
Microsoft describes Secure Score as a measurement of security posture, with a higher score indicating that more recommended actions have been taken.
The useful question is therefore not:
“How do we get to 100%?”
It is:
“Which recommendations materially reduce our business risk?”
Where Do You Find Microsoft Secure Score?
Secure Score is available through the Microsoft Defender portal.
Go to the Microsoft Defender security portal and open:
Secure Score
Microsoft’s current documentation places the Secure Score experience at:
security.microsoft.com/securescore
and provides a dedicated Recommended actions area for improvement opportunities.
Depending on the Microsoft services and licences in your environment, the score can reflect controls relating to areas such as:
identity
devices
applications
data
Microsoft 365 security
The exact recommendations available depend on the services your organisation uses. Microsoft explicitly notes that Secure Score is representative of the Microsoft security services in use.
How Is the Score Calculated?
Each improvement action has a potential point value.
You gain points when Microsoft detects that the associated security control has been implemented or an applicable action has been completed.
Some actions can receive partial credit.
For example, Microsoft notes that Identity Secure Score can award partial completion for controls such as enabling MFA for only some users rather than the entire organisation.
The broad idea is:
Current points ÷ available points = Secure Score percentage
But that percentage should be treated as an indicator of control adoption rather than an absolute statement of security.
Is 100% Secure Score the Goal?
Not necessarily.
In theory, completing every applicable recommendation would maximise the score.
In practice, some recommendations may:
not fit your architecture
conflict with operational requirements
require unavailable licensing
create disproportionate user impact
be mitigated by another control
Microsoft’s own guidance emphasises balancing security with usability, because security controls have an impact on users.
That means a sensible security programme may intentionally leave some points unclaimed.
The important thing is that those decisions are understood and documented.
A company with an 82% score and well-reasoned compensating controls may be in a better real-world position than a company with 95% that enabled recommendations without testing their impact.

MFA Should Be a Baseline, Not a Score-Chasing Exercise
If Secure Score says only part of the organisation has MFA enabled, that is more than a scoring opportunity.
It is a real identity risk.
Microsoft explicitly uses MFA rollout as an example of a control where partial implementation can produce partial score.
But the operational objective should be:
protect the accounts that matter
not:
collect the points.
Pay particular attention to:
administrators
finance
executives
users with access to sensitive systems
For privileged roles, stronger phishing-resistant methods may be more appropriate than relying solely on push notifications or SMS.
Protect Administrator Accounts Separately
A normal employee account and a Global Administrator account should not necessarily have identical security treatment.
Review:
number of administrators
standing privilege
MFA strength
emergency access accounts
daily-use administrator accounts
A high Secure Score combined with excessive administrative privilege is still an uncomfortable environment.
Least privilege should be part of the security discussion even where it does not produce the most dramatic immediate score increase.
Device Security Matters Too
Secure Score can also reflect device security where the organisation uses Microsoft Defender and related services.
Microsoft’s current Secure Score for Devices represents the collective configuration state of devices across areas including operating system, applications, network and security controls.
Relevant improvements may involve:
endpoint protection
firewall
attack-surface reduction
encryption
vulnerability remediation
security configuration
This is another reason Secure Score is more useful when considered alongside Defender Vulnerability Management and Exposure Management rather than viewed as an isolated percentage.
Microsoft now explicitly prioritises security recommendations using factors including threat, breach likelihood and value.

Use the Recommended Actions Page Properly
In Secure Score, open:
Recommended actions
For each recommendation, review:
potential score increase
affected users/devices
implementation details
user impact
prerequisites
whether it applies to your environment
Microsoft documents this area as the main place to work through improvement actions.
Do not implement 25 recommendations in one afternoon.
Prioritise them.
Test changes.
Then measure the effect.
Look at Score History
One of Secure Score’s most useful features is the ability to track changes over time.
Microsoft provides history and trends so organisations can understand which activities caused their score to increase or regress.
This lets you answer:
Why did our score fall this week?
Possible reasons include:
configuration regression
new users
new devices
Microsoft adding/reweighting recommendations
licences changing
controls being removed
A falling score does not automatically mean somebody changed a setting incorrectly.
Microsoft continues to update Secure Score recommendations and calculations as its security products evolve.

Licensing Affects What You Can Score
Secure Score only reflects controls associated with the services available in the environment.
That means two similar companies can have different:
available recommendations
maximum score
achievable actions
depending on licensing and products deployed.
Microsoft explicitly says Secure Score represents the Microsoft security services your organisation uses.
So comparing:
Company A = 82%
with:
Company B = 74%
isn't necessarily meaningful unless their environments are broadly comparable.

Document Accepted Risks
Suppose a recommendation is technically valid but inappropriate for a particular workload.
Do not simply ignore it forever.
Document:
why it isn't being implemented
what risk remains
compensating controls
review date
owner
Modern Microsoft security products also increasingly support exceptions/exclusions so organisations can distinguish genuinely accepted risk from simply unfinished work. Defender Vulnerability Management, for example, supports exceptions that can affect exposure and secure-score reporting.
This makes reporting more honest.
A Practical Improvement Order for SMEs
For many SMEs, I would prioritise something like:
1. Identity
MFA, strong authentication, privileged accounts.
2. Email
Phishing and malicious-content protection.
3. Devices
Endpoint protection, encryption, patching and attack-surface controls.
4. Permissions
Reduce excessive access and old privileged accounts.
5. Vulnerabilities
Address exploitable weaknesses on important systems.
6. Data
Review sensitive-data and sharing controls.
7. Lower-impact optimisation
Then work through less urgent recommendations.
That order will vary by organisation.
The point is to create a risk-based roadmap, not blindly sort by Secure Score points.

Secure Score vs Exposure Score
This distinction is increasingly useful in 2026.
Think of:
Secure Score
as:
How much recommended security hardening have we implemented?
and Exposure Management as helping answer:
Where are attackers most likely to find useful routes through our environment?
Microsoft Security Exposure Management provides a broader attack-surface view across identities, devices, cloud resources and other assets.
You want both perspectives.
A configuration score without attack-path context is incomplete.
Attack-path information without improving configuration is also incomplete.
Secure Score vs Compliance
A high Secure Score does not prove compliance with:
Cyber Essentials
ISO 27001
GDPR
contractual requirements
industry-specific standards
Those frameworks have their own requirements.
Secure Score can provide useful evidence and identify controls that support a wider security programme.
But:
security score ≠ compliance certification.
That distinction should be explicit in any board-level discussion.

The Secure Score Checklist
When reviewing Microsoft Secure Score:
1. Open Recommended actions.
2. Identify identity and privileged-access risks first.
3. Check endpoint/device recommendations.
4. Compare actions against real business risk.
5. Consider user and operational impact.
6. Prioritise exploitable weaknesses and critical assets.
7. Implement changes in controlled stages.
8. Track history and investigate regressions.
9. Document accepted risks and exceptions.
10. Review it regularly.
11. Combine Secure Score with vulnerability and exposure data.
12. Never treat the percentage as proof that the organisation is secure.
The key principle is:
Improve security first. Let the score follow.
